Everyone Loves It Meatloaf
- Ready In:
- 1hr 20mins
- Ingredients:
- 14
- Yields:
-
1 meatloaf
- Serves:
- 10
ingredients
-
Meatloaf
- 2 lbs very lean hamburger
- 1 tablespoon onion powder
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1⁄2 teaspoon celery salt
- 1 tablespoon Old Bay Seasoning
- 1⁄4 cup catsup
- 1⁄3 cup ranch dressing
- 2 eggs, slightly beaten
- 1⁄2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
- 3⁄4 cup breadcrumbs
-
Glaze
- 1 teaspoon hot sauce
- 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
- 1⁄2 cup catsup
- 2 tablespoons brown sugar
directions
- Mix all ingredients for the meatloaf together, and press into an 8x8 baking pan.
- Mix together the glaze ingredients, and spread over the top of the meatloaf. Bake for 1 hour at 375 degrees.
